In Cameroon, a massive health investigation is underway in Douala, where 1,500 health workers are deployed. They go door to door to try to find the infected people. Report to healthcare staff.

In the Democratic Republic of Congo, the commune of Gombe, in the city center of Kinshasa experienced its first day of confinement on Monday. This posh district of the capital is considered to be the epicenter of the COVID-19 epidemic in the country. Police checkpoints have been put in place to isolate the town from the rest of the city. And it is now impossible to travel without an exemption.

Finally, the Covid-19 pandemic forced the closure of the vast majority of schools on the continent. But that does not mean that the students are on vacation or that the teachers are not working. Several public television channels broadcast lessons to schoolchildren, to help them continue their education as best they can.
